Experiencia de entrevista en Amazon (SDE 1 – 2 años de experiencia)

Ronda 1: 2 preguntas en lápiz y papel

  1. Dada una lista enlazada, invierta todos los Nodes en los lugares pares. P.ej
    Given list - 1-2-3-4-5
    Output list - 1-4-3-2-5
  2. No recuerdo, pero algo basado en un árbol. Era una pregunta fácil.

Ronda 2: Cara a cara (1 hora) 2 entrevistadores

  1. Dado un árbol, encuentre una manera de serializarlo y deserializarlo nuevamente.
  2. Otra pregunta basada en árboles.
  3. ¿Qué es caché? Diferencia b/n caché y hashmap.

Ronda 3: Cara a cara (1 hora) 2 entrevistadores

  1. Recorrido en orden de niveles en zigzag de un árbol.
  2. Pregunta BST. convertir array dada a BST.
  3. Discusión del proyecto y preguntas a su alrededor, como por qué MongoDB y no Elasticsearch o DynamoDB.

Ronda 4:

  1. ¿Por qué quieres unirte a Amazon?
  2. ¿El proyecto más desafiante que has hecho hasta ahora?
  3. ¿Qué haría en caso de conflicto en su diseño recomendado con otra persona?
  4. Pregunta DS basada en el árbol.

Ronda 5:

  1. Explique el proyecto anterior.
  2. diferencia b / w Mongo vs Mysql. – En esto, siguió profundizando, uno tras otro. Entonces, mejor que estés preparado en tu mejor momento.
  3. Multiproceso. Concepto de mutex, semáforo.
  4. Escriba un programa para sumar 2 números grandes. Manejar negativo también.

Finalmente recibí una oferta después de una semana.

Publicación traducida automáticamente

Artículo escrito por GeeksforGeeks-1 y traducido por Barcelona Geeks. The original can be accessed here. Licence: CCBY-SA

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*